Waymo robotaxis approved to expand across 18 California counties

Waymo's autonomous robotaxi service has received approval from the California Public Utilities Commission to expand across 18 counties in California, including major areas in Northern and Southern California such as the San Francisco Bay Area, Los Angeles, Sacramento, and San Diego. The expansion will be gradual, supported by Waymo’s safety framework, and includes deployment of all-electric Jaguar I-PACE and Waymo’s custom Ojai robotaxi models.
